Qi, also commonly spelled ch’i (in Wade-Giles romanization) or ki (in romanized Japanese), is a fundamental concept of traditional Chinese culture. Qi is believed to be part of every living thing that exists, as a kind of “life force” or “spiritual energy.” It is frequently translated as “energy flow,” or literally as “air” or “breath.” (For example, tia-nqì, literally “sky breath”, is the ordinary Chinese word for “weather). In Mandarin Chinese it is pronounced something like “chee” in English, but the tongue position is different.
